10th Annual Stevie Ray Vaughan Ride and Concert, a Real Pride and Joy
by Tracie Carlson

Sunday October 3rd, 2004 proved to be everything we had hoped for and more. It was a day to honor Stevie’s 50th Birthday and to celebrate the 10th Anniversary of the Stevie Ray Vaughan Remembrance Ride and Concert. Proceeds from the event benefit the Stevie Ray Vaughan Memorial Scholarship Fund. The Scholarships are awarded to aspiring music students
at Greiner Middle School in the heart of Oak Cliff, where Stevie himself spent his childhood. )(There's a special note of thanks from Stevie Ray Vaughan's personal road manager, Cutter  Brandenburg aka Mr. Cee below).

Not only did the sun shine this year (for the most part), but also an overwhelming amount of support came from each and every direction. Multi-talented Guitar World Senior Editor Andy Aledort also took the stage to join Alan Haynes, Denny Freeman, Mike Kindred and Jim Suhler with Double Trouble as the headline band for this year’s concert. An impressive line-up including Krackerjack, Grady, Joe Bonamassa, Wes Jeans, Beth Garner and Soulville all helped to make this year our best ever.

A Special Thanks from Cutter Brandenburg

I personally want to thank all those who helped make the 10th Annual SRV Remembrance Ride and Concert the best ever. Most of all, I’d like to send a special thanks to the fans who attended, who I consider family. What better day to celebrate Stevie’s life then on his 50th Birthday. And a wonderful time it was to come together in Stevie’s name for such a great cause. The love shown that day equaled the love Stevie had for us all. We were all humbled by the experience.

Each year the event gets better and better, but this year surpassed all of my hopes and dreams because I found the guy who introduced me to Stevie over 35 years ago. I was so blessed to meet Stevie. Knowing him changed my entire life and still to this day I reap the benefits.

Through the years, many have asked for my email address because they want to talk about Stevie. Ya know, he always referred to his fans as “the family”. He would say “Cee, our family is growing all the time”. He would want all of us who knew and loved him to take the time to talk to our other family members. My greatest joy is in sharing stories about Stevie and all my friends over all the years. So please feel free to contact me anytime. It is very important to me to be able to do this One last note; I’ve decided to write a book about my adventures on the road and probably 75% will be about Stevie. I remember so well how he just wanted to play and all who heard him could feel the love in his music. Stevie Ray Vaughan was the real deal and he still lives in the hearts of his friends and family all over the world.
